Same here.  One of the huge selling points for Elecraft has always been the after-sale service and longevity of the product.  I was happy to upgrade my K3 to the new synths, but now I find out that if, for example, my 2nd receiver goes full belly up some time in the near future I probably won't be able to get a replacement. ... and by Elecraft choice rather than by component obsolescence.    That kind of changes the story for me.  The K3 line itself is far from being obsolete performance-wise.

I expected this, and in preparation received an RA number to have my
own K3 and P3 packed out this month while parts are available. Still,
I find it sad.

The value proposition from Elecraft has been easy to justify: buy a
base model radio and then add options as necessary or possible. With
the arrival of the K4, the K3-line is seemingly being abandoned. It is
10-ish years old, but still great.

Of course, I understand. Elecraft is a small company and it is not
practical to keep all the parts available forever. But unlike the K1,
KX1, and some K2 options, where components became unavailable, the K3
transition feels different somehow.

Ah, well.  The times they are a changin'.

Mike,

The filters definitely, they are the same ones used in the K4.
The 2nd RX and 2m option may or may not be available.  They are building
no more, so whenever stock is depleted, they will be gone.
